rhonchō — meaning in English
Latin → English · translate English → Latin instead
English meaning
- snore verb To make a loud, rough breathing sound while asleep.
Senses
rhonchō is used for these senses in English:
- snore (ambitransitive) To breathe during sleep with harsh, snorting noises caused by vibration of the soft palate.
snore — full definition
- verb To make a loud, rough breathing sound while asleep.
- noun The sound made when someone snores.
